DESCRIPTION:The Rezillos are a punk/new wave band formed in Edinburgh\, Scotland\, in 1976. Their independent debut single\, ‘I Can’t Stand My Baby’ shot them to underground fame initially via airings on the radio show of BBC Radio 1’s John Peel. \nTheir follow up classic singles ‘My Baby Does Good Sculptures’\, ‘Top of the Pops’ and ‘Destination Venus’ signalled critically acclaimed milestones for the band. \nThe Rezillos recorded their landmark album ‘Can’t Stand the Rezillos’ in New York’s fabled Power Station studio\, immersed themselves in the local music scene and dropped in during downtime to play a gig at CBGB’s\, the hub of Punk Rock music. The album reached the top 10 in the UK album chart and is lauded as a punk classic. \nAn AGMP Concerts presentation.

DESCRIPTION:THE STYLE COUNCILLORS‘Café Bleu’ Tour \nThe seminal debut album recreated live by the world’s only tribute to The Style Council. \nThe Style Councillors will be recreating the seminal debut LP by The Style Council\, ‘Café Bleu’\, along with all of the hits and classics in the finest celebration of Paul Weller’s 1980’s group where some of his best songs were recorded. \nAfter the dissolution of The Jam in 1982\, Paul Weller joined forces with Mick Talbot\, formerly of The Merton Parkas\, Dexys Midnight Runners and The Bureau\, to form The Style Council. The band released a string of successful singles between 1983-1989 such as Speak Like a Child\, Money-Go-Round\, Long Hot Summer\, My Ever Changing Moods\, You’re The Best Thing\, Shout To The Top\, Walls Come Tumbling Down\, A Solid Bond In Your Heart\, Come To Milton Keynes\, The Lodgers\, Why I Went Missing\, and more. \nThe Style Councillors are a 9-piece band who were formed in 2013 by Darren Fletcher. Having quickly built a hugely loyal fanbase The Style Councillors are in big demand on the live circuit for fans of Paul Weller and The Style Council. \nAn AGMP Concerts presentation.

DESCRIPTION:Martin Stephenson & The Daintees hail from the North East of England. Their debut single ‘Roll On Summertime’ was released in 1982 on Kitchenware Records (home of Prefab Sprout\, The Kane Gang\, Hurrah!). \n‘Boat To Bolivia’ was the debut album by Martin Stephenson & The Daintees. After appearances on Channel 4’s ‘The Tube’ and BBC2’s ‘Whistle Test’ the album went on to become one of the essential releases of 1986. \nIn 1988\, the second Martin Stephenson & The Daintees album ‘Gladsome\, Humour & Blue’ was released which featured the singles ‘There Comes A Time’ & ‘Wholly Humble Heart’. \nDon’t miss Martin Stephenson & The Daintees perform music from the ‘Gladsome\, Humour & Blue’ LP along with other classics and fan favourites. \nAn AGMP Concerts presentation.

DESCRIPTION:SECRET AFFAIR + PURPLE HEARTS \nEseential mod revival double bill. \nFormed from the ashes of Power Pop band New Hearts\, Secret Affair built their reputation with sell out shows at the Bridge House in Canning Town\, London and with a high profile support slot on The Jam’s 1979 tour. \nSecret Affair went on to have 5 x Top 40 singles\, ‘Time For Action’\, ‘Let Your Heart Dance\, ‘My World’\, ‘Do You Know?’\, ‘Sound of Confusion’\, and 3 acclaimed LP’s\, ‘Glory Boys’\, ‘Behind Closed Doors’ and ‘Business As Usual’\, released before splitting in 1982. After reforming in 2002 by popular demand Secret Affair released a brand new album ‘Soho Dreams’ in 2012 and a limited edition 45 cover of Frank Wilson’s ‘Do I Love You (Indeed I Do)’. \nFormed in 1977\, Purple Hearts were one of the main bands from the ‘Mod Revival’ era along with The Jam\, Secret Affair\, The Lambrettas\, & The Chords. Their debut single ‘Millions Like Us’ hit the UK charts and was swiftly followed up with ‘Frustration’. \nIn 1980 Purple Hearts released their debut album ‘Beat That!’ along with a single from the LP ‘Jimmy’\, which also reached the UK charts. Two more singles ‘My Life’s A Jigsaw’ and ‘Plane Crash’ came out before the band split in 1982. \nAn AGMP Concerts presentation.

DESCRIPTION:XTC’s legendary drummer\, Terry Chambers\, is back on the road with his band EXTC (named and approved by XTC frontman\, Andy Partridge).  \nEmerging out of the post-punk and new-wave explosion of the late 70s\, XTC experienced global success touring with the likes of The Police and Talking Heads. Sadly\, their legions of loyal fans would be left in limbo when in 1982 XTC stopped touring\, becoming a studio-based entity. \nEXTC were formed in 2019 by XTC’s drummer Terry Chambers\, performing classic XTC material such as Making Plans For Nigel\, Senses Working Overtime\, Mayor of Simpleton\, Generals and Majors\, Sgt. Rock (Is Going To Help Me)\, Love on a Farmboy’s Wages and many more. \nAn AGMP Concerts presentation.
